Ireland Club Team Named For Dalriada Cup Clash

The Ireland Club Team to play their Scottish counterparts in Millbrae, Ayr on Friday night (kick-off 7.30pm) has been named. The Ireland Club XV will be defending the Dalriada Cup which they won last season.

The 23-man Ireland squad shows eight changes, including six new caps, to the side which defeated England 30-20 Counties last month.

Gerry Hurley of Cork Constitution will again captain the team and he has a new half-back partner as Gavin Dunne  of St. Mary’s College comes in for his first cap.

Richie Mullane is again selected at full-back with Cian Aherne and Darragh Fanning on the wings and Stuart Morrow and Killian Lett forming the centre partnership.

Colm McMahon, Risteard Byrne and Kevin Griffin will combine in the front row. Clontarf’s Simon Crawford has been ruled out through injury, so Brian Quill from UCC will make his debut alongside Ben Reilly in the second row.

The back row is unchanged with William Ryan and Danny Kenny packing down alongside the experienced Frank Cogan.

Among the replacements, Charlie Butterworth, Shane Grannell, Darragh Lyons and Foster Horan are all in line to win their first Club International caps.
